What is Callbank?

Callbank is a cloud-based telecommunication service or platform that provides businesses with advanced call management systems. It is designed to handle incoming and outgoing calls, call routing, IVR (Interactive Voice Response), call recording, analytics, and even AI-based automation — all from a single, user-friendly dashboard.

Imagine a virtual bank of calls where every interaction is recorded, analyzed, optimized, and utilized for growth. That’s the vision behind Callbank.

Key Features of Callbank

  1. Cloud Telephony Infrastructure
    Callbank removes the need for traditional PBX systems or hardware setups. All communication takes place through the internet, allowing businesses to operate from anywhere with just a laptop and a headset.
  2. Advanced IVR Systems
    With customizable IVR menus, customers can navigate to the right department without waiting endlessly. This improves both customer satisfaction and agent efficiency.
  3. Call Analytics and Reporting
    Callbank provides real-time insights into call duration, agent performance, customer satisfaction trends, and peak calling times. These analytics help businesses make data-driven decisions.
  4. Call Recording and Playback
    Every call is automatically recorded and securely stored. This feature is essential for quality assurance, dispute resolution, and training purposes.
  5. AI and Chat Integration
    Some advanced Callbank systems integrate AI to automate basic queries or combine with live chat platforms to offer omnichannel customer support.
  6. Number Masking and Privacy
    Protecting user identity is critical in industries like healthcare, e-commerce, or delivery services. Callbank’s number masking feature keeps both customer and agent numbers private during communication.
